Beware of scam websites making fake claims of government affiliation

…These scams operate through websites which charge a fee for services offered freely or at a lower cost by government or charge for services they never end up delivering. This scam commonly targets registrations and renewals, for services such as: business registrations grants tax file numbers travel … You can report scams to the ACCC via the report a scam page on SCAMwatch. … SCAMwatch has issued previous radars and a media release on scams which impersonate government: September 2011 - ACCC media release - International internet sweep targets websites with false sponsorships July 2011: Beware of scam calls offering carbon tax compensation payments May 2011: Scammers pose as…
